The Ottawa Titans 2021 schedule is here.
The Titans hit the field for the first time in franchise history on May 27 when they face the Tri-City ValleyCats in its first of 96 games during the campaign.
As part of the Can-Am Division, the Titans will face the Québec Capitales, Trois-Rivières Aigles, Tri-City, New York Boulders, New Jersey Jackals, Sussex County Miners and Washington Wild Things.
The Titans play at home on these holiday dates: June 20, Father’s Day vs. Quebec; June 24, St. Jean Baptiste Day vs. New York; July 1, Canada Day vs. Tri-City and Sept. 6, Labour Day vs. New Jersey.
The regular season concludes Sept. 12 when the Titans battle Sussex County.
